Role Overview:
The purpose of the Groomer position is to ensure Lutsen Mountains is producing a high quality snow surface, providing a safe and enjoyable skiing experience for guests of all skill levels.
Responsibilities:
- Performs daily equipment inspections at start of shift, completes log, and maintains equipment fluid levels.
- Keeping all required log sheets and records current and accurate
- Groom ski runs to seamless corduroy using a combination of blade and tiller without unnecessary stress on the machine.
- Builds and maintains ski lift loading and unloading ramps as qualified and as directed by Snow Surface Supervisor
- Report any issues or concerns that arise with the machine in use
- Ensure management is immediately informed and consulted on all abnormal or unusual conditions, incidents, or system malfunctions
- Maintain and track operation, vehicle, and fuel record each shift
- Keep work environment clean and organized
- Complying with OSHA and company procedures, rules, and regulations
- Work well in a team-oriented environment
- Other duties as assigned
Minimum skills, experience, and education required for this job:
- Has previous heavy equipment experience.
- 1 year previous grooming machine experience required
- 3+ years previous grooming machine experience required
- Able to effectively communicate and follow grooming plans
- Works in a detailed and methodical manner
- A valid driver's license is required.
- Basic knowledge of snowcat/heavy equipment maintenance and operation.
- Physical Capabilities: bend, twist, push, pull, stand, lift 50lbs.
- Must be comfortable working in an outdoor all-season environment.
- Ability to work weekends, holidays, evenings, and overnights.
